Board of Supervisors Makes Selections to Cannabis Micro-Grant and Load Advisory Committee

HUMBOLDT COUNTY (KIEM) – Project Trellis is making new steps, all to get the program up and running.

The Humboldt County Board of Supervisors formed the Cannabis Micro-Grant and Loan Advisory Committee.

Out of eleven applicants, the Board of Supervisors appointed two at-large and two alternates to the committee.

Rich Ames and Hannah Joy were appointed as at-large members. Ames will represent the banking and finance aspect, while Joy represents the cannabis industry. Brian St. Clair and Thomas Handwerker were both selected as alternates.

Back in May 2018, The Board of Supervisors established the committee. In total, the committee will have nine members. The other five members have also been selected by the Board of Supervisors.

Economic Development Director Scott Adair SAYS, this is a great next step for Project Trellis.

The committee is planned to meet within the next 30 days.
